Job Search and Career Advice Platform

Enable job alerts via email!

Data & AI Engineer (12 Months)

Zurich Insurance Company

Singapore

On-site

SGD 96,000 - 120,000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ading insurance firm in Singapore is seeking a skilled Data & AI Engineer to enhance and maintain data platform architecture. This role involves delivering advanced data solutions, managing ETL processes, and collaborating with cross-functional teams. The ideal candidate will have 8+ years of experience in data engineering, proficiency in SQL, and familiarity with Azure Cloud services. Join a company that values diverse perspectives and continuous growth.

Qualifications

  • 8+ years of experience in a Data Engineer role.
  • Advanced working knowledge of SQL and relational databases.
  • Experience in building and optimizing big data pipelines.
  • Knowledge of Data Modeling and Master Data Management.

Responsibilities

  • Delivering solutions using advanced techniques in data processing.
  • Maintaining and supporting automation solutions.
  • Designing and implementing data pipelines in Azure Cloud.
  • Collaborating with teams to operationalize AI use cases.

Skills

Data modeling
ETL operations
Data visualization
SQL
Data pipeline management
Problem-solving
Communication skills

Education

Degree in Computer Science or related field

Tools

Azure cloud services
Databricks
Power BI
Control-M
Airflow
Python
Java
Job description
The Opportunity

We are seeking a skilled Data & AI Engineer to join our Data & Digital team. This role focuses on enhancing and maintaining data platform architecture, operationalizing Generative AI solutions, and implementing automation solutions.

This individual must be self-directed and comfortable in addressing the data needs of multiple teams, systems, and products. The right candidate will be enthusiastic about even redesign the data architecture to support the next generation of products and data initiatives.

The expertise of the Data & AI Engineer is crucial in building a robust data & AI infrastructure so that all stakeholders have seamless access to reliable and accurate data.

Your Role
  • Delivering solutions using advanced techniques in data modeling, ETL, data visualization, and more to derive insights from both structured and unstructured data.
  • Maintaining, reviewing, and supporting the development of automation solutions.
  • Integrating, consolidating, cleansing, and structuring large data sets to facilitate business insights and reporting.
  • Designing, implementing, and maintaining data pipelines for data ingestion, processing, and transformation in Azure Cloud.
  • Proactively understanding business requirements and translating them into superior software implementations using an agile approach.
  • Collaborating with data scientists and analysts to understand data needs and operationalize GenAI use cases and automation.
  • Set up robust cloud infrastructure to enable reliable and scalable deployment of AI / ML solutions in production. Deploy models as APIs or microservices to integrate seamlessly with existing applications, applying MLOps and DevOps best practices.
  • Utilizing Databricks, Azure Data Factory, or similar technologies to create and maintain ETL operations, including data quality checks.
  • Enhancing the scalability, efficiency, and cost-effectiveness of data pipelines.
  • Monitoring and resolving data pipeline issues to ensure data consistency and availability, while working towards improving data quality.
  • Defining and implementing data governance processes.
Your Skills and Experience
  • Approximately 8+ years of experience in a Data Engineer role with a degree in Computer Science, Data Science, Information Systems, or a related field.
  • Advanced working knowledge of SQL and experience with relational databases.
  • Experience in building and optimizing 'big data' pipelines, architectures, and datasets.
  • Experience in incremental loading, ETL jobs operationalization, Data Migration,
  • Proven history of manipulating, processing, and extracting value from large datasets, including building processes for data transformation, data structures, metadata, dependency, and workload management.
  • Working knowledge of Master Data and Reference Data Management.
  • Working knowledge of Data Modeling.
  • Experience in developing and integrating Power BI reports and dashboards.
  • Experience in supporting and collaborating with cross-functional teams in a dynamic environment.
  • Working knowledge of building user interfaces using web technologies.
  • Experience with the following software / tools :
  • Azure cloud services- Microservices, APIs, Function, Databricks, ADF, LogicApp, AI Foundry.
  • Relational SQL and NoSQL databases.
  • Data pipeline and workflow management tools : Control-M, Airflow.
  • Basic understanding of stream-processing systems : Storm, Spark-Streaming.
  • Object-oriented / scripting languages : Python, pySpark, Java, Scala.
  • Web technologies : Streamlit, React.js, HTML, etc.
  • Basic knowledge of Data Science, LLMs, operationalization of AI solutions.
  • Strong problem-solving abilities.
  • Excellent verbal and written communication skills.
You are the heart & soul of Zurich!

At Zurich, we like to think outside the box and challenge the status quo. We take an optimistic approach by focusing on the positives and constantly asking What can go right?

People are Zurich’s most important asset. Their varied skills, perspectives and experiences drive innovation. And they reflect the breadth and diversity of our customers, suppliers, communities and investors around the world. We are committed to attracting and retaining talented individuals from a variety of backgrounds and experiences.

Let’s continue to grow together!

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.